Pros & cons
QEval
+ Transcribes and analyzes 100% of interactions across multiple channels rather than a sampled subset
+ Combines QA scoring with real-time agent assist and compliance monitoring in one platform
- Built specifically for contact center QA, not for general meeting notes or team collaboration
Rafiki
+ Combines note-taking, coaching, and revenue intelligence in one platform
- Some advertised capabilities are listed as upcoming rather than fully shipped
